Job Description
Duties & Responsibilities
  • Health, Safety & Compliance Lead and continuously improve the site's EHS strategy in line with corporate and regulatory requirements
  • Ensure compliance with Irish HSA regulations, EU Directives, and global standards
  • Maintain and develop ISO 45001 and ISO 14001 management systems
  • Act as EHS lead during audits and inspections (FDA, Notified Body, Corporate)
  • Oversee incident investigations, root cause analysis, and corrective actions
  • Managing daily, weekly, or monthly EHS reporting and metrics for the facility
  • Coordinate and manage EHS induction and training programmes for all site personnel
Manufacturing & Operational Safety
  • Support a multi-shift, high-volume manufacturing environment
  • Lead risk assessments across Cleanrooms and controlled environments
  • Automation and equipment safety
  • Chemical and hazardous materials handling
  • Ensure safe execution of engineering projects, expansions, and contractor activities
Sustainability & ESG Leadership
  • Drive site sustainability initiatives aligned with corporate ESG goals
  • Lead programs to reduce energy consumption and carbon footprint, waste (including regulated medical waste) and water usage
  • Support sustainability reporting (e.g., CSRD, internal ESG metrics)
  • Promote circular economy and environmentally responsible practices
Culture & Leadership
  • Build a proactive, engagement-driven safety culture
  • Partner with site leadership to embed accountability at all levels
  • Lead team of EHS specialists ensuring ongoing growth and development of team members
  • Deliver training and awareness programs across EHS and sustainability
  • Adhere to Merits values and drive employee engagement through safety and environmental initiatives
Continuous Improvement
  • Integrate EHS into Lean and operational excellence initiatives
  • Analyse performance data and drive improvements through KPIs
  • Identify opportunities to enhance safety and environmental performance
Summary of Minimum Qualifications & Experience
  • Degree in Environmental Health & Safety, Engineering, or a related discipline
  • 7+ years' experience in EHS within a regulated manufacturing environment
  • Experience in an FDA-regulated or highly regulated industry is highly desirable
  • Proven track record in leading sustainability or ESG initiatives
  • Strong knowledge of Irish and EU EHS legislation
  • Experience with cleanroom or high-volume manufacturing environments
  • Excellent leadership, influencing, and communication skills
  • Highly motivated team player with strong collaboration skills
  • Data-driven approach with a continuous improvement mindset
  • Experience with EHS systems (e.g., Enablon, Intelex)
